The Evolution of Sports Betting in the U.S.
The journey of sports betting in the United States is more intricate than many realize. Originally, betting on sports was widespread and accepted. However, the landscape began to shift dramatically after the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A) was enacted in 1992, effectively banning sports betting across most states. This act left Nevada as the sole bastion for regulated sports betting, creating a massive shadow market in other states.
In May 2018, a seismic shift occurred when the U.S. Supreme Court struck down PASPA, opening up a floodgate of possibilities for states to pursue legal sports betting. This ruling was more than just a legal change; it ignited a cultural acceptance and enthusiasm for betting on sports that had long been relegated to the underground. As a result, many states quickly moved to legalize and regulate this practice, leading to a surge in sportsbooks emerging across the nation, including within tribal jurisdictions like that of the Seneca Nation.

Tribal Sovereignty and Gaming Rights
The concept of tribal sovereignty plays a significant role in the gaming rights of the Seneca Nation. Tribal nations have the authority to govern themselves, which includes regulatory practices regarding gaming operations. The Indian Gaming Regulatory Act (IGRA) provides a framework for tribes to conduct gaming, emphasizing their right to establish and operate gambling facilities without excessive state interference.
The Seneca Nation leverages this sovereignty to operate its sportsbook, creating a unique environment that differentiates it from state-run entities. This means they can design their own rules and offer diverse betting options, aligning their practices with their community's values and needs. Types of Bets Available
When it comes to the types of bets, the variety is both broad and enticing. Bettors can place traditional straight bets, where they simply pick a team to win. Additionally, there are more complex options like parlays, combining multiple selections for a higher payout, albeit with higher risk involved.
Futures bets also entice those willing to look ahead, allowing wagers on events well before they happen, such as who will win a championship. Then there are over/under bets, where players bet on whether the score will be above or below a specified figure. The diversity allows bettors to tailor their strategies based on personal insights and game analysis.
